Abstract

In this paper, we present the preliminary methods for detection of the boundary layer based on backscattered signals from a mobile LIDAR (LIght Detection And Ranging) developed at Council for Scientific and Industrial Research (CSIR) National Laser Centre (NLC), Pretoria (25.5° S; 28.2° E), South Africa. We have concentrated on two different methods, such as (a) statistical and (b) slope. The preliminary study concludes that the statistical method provides a reasonable temporal evolution of the boundary layer height in comparison with the slope method.
